The latest patch for Mario Kart, version 1.2.0, has introduced several significant changes aimed at enhancing the gaming experience. One of the most notable adjustments is the modification of CPU opponents, making them easier to compete against. This change is expected to provide a more enjoyable experience for players who may have found the previous difficulty level challenging.
In addition to the adjustments to CPU behavior, the update also brings a new feature for players engaged in Free Roam mode. Gamers will now receive notifications when they have successfully collected all items in this mode, allowing for a more streamlined experience as they explore the game’s expansive environments.
These updates reflect the developers’ commitment to improving gameplay and ensuring that all players, regardless of skill level, can enjoy the thrills of racing. With these enhancements, fans of the franchise can look forward to a more accessible and engaging Mario Kart experience.
